Question 1125506: Water travels at 10' per second through a 2" pipe with inside diameter of 2.067". Determine amt.(gals.)the pipe delivers per hr.
10' per sec. = 36000' per hr.
Unsure how to solve. Non-homework.

Water travels at 10' per second through a 2" pipe with inside diameter of 2.067". Determine amt.(gals.)the pipe delivers per hr.
10' per sec. = 36000' per hr.
:
Think of it as a cylinder of water with 2.067" diameter and 36000 ft long.
Find it's volume in cubic ft
Find the radius in ft: = .086125 ft is the radius
V =
V = 838.9 cu/ft
Convert to gallons 1 cu/ft = 7.481 gal
V = 838.9 * 7.481
V = 6,275.82 gallons in 1 hr
